Go Ahead

Go Ahead is a heartwarming drama that tells the story of three unrelated children who come to form a close-knit family bond. This series revolves around three children from troubled homes who find solace and support in one another. Living under the same roof, they navigate the ups and downs of childhood and adolescence together, creating an unbreakable bond that transcends their difficult pasts. Go Ahead masterfully explores the themes of family, love, and healing, showcasing how chosen families can be just as strong and meaningful as biological ones. The Bad Kids

The Bad Kids is a suspenseful and thought-provoking drama that follows a group of children who accidentally witness a murder. This crime drama takes a dark and twisted turn when three children stumble upon a murder scene and decide to blackmail the perpetrator. What begins as a seemingly harmless act quickly spirals into a complex web of lies, deceit, and moral ambiguity, forcing the children to confront the consequences of their actions. The Bad Kids is a masterclass in suspense, keeping viewers on the edge of their seats as the story unfolds, and delves into the complexities of human nature, challenging our notions of good and evil. The drama explores the psychological impact of violence and trauma on young minds, raising questions about the nature of innocence and the corrupting influence of power. Nirvana in Fire

Nirvana in Fire may be a historical drama primarily focused on political intrigue and revenge, but the young actor playing the character Fei Liu adds a delightful and endearing element to the story. Though not the central focus, Fei Liu is the loyal and highly skilled bodyguard of the protagonist, Mei Changsu. Despite his limited dialogue, Fei Liu's actions and expressions speak volumes, showcasing his unwavering devotion and protective nature. His childlike innocence and occasional naiveté provide moments of levity amidst the drama's serious tone, making him a fan favorite.
